Creality K1C 3D Printer

The Creality K1C 3D Printer is designed for high-speed, high-precision 3D printing, making it ideal for both professionals and hobbyists. Offering exceptional performance, dual-gear extruders, and advanced AI-assisted features, the K1C allows you to print intricate, detailed models at a fast pace.

Key Features:

  • Speed: Achieves print speeds of up to 300mm/s, reducing production time significantly without compromising quality.
  • High Precision: With a layer height range of 0.1mm to 0.35mm, the K1C ensures crisp, accurate prints every time.
  • AI-Assisted Features: Includes an AI camera and LiDAR sensor, allowing real-time monitoring and automatic adjustments for optimal print quality.
  • Filament Compatibility: Compatible with a wide range of filaments including PLA, PETG, ABS, TPU, and more.
  • User-Friendly: Hands-free auto bed leveling and a 4.3″ color touchscreen make the K1C easy to operate, even for beginners.

The Creality K1C 3D Printer is a must-have for those seeking efficiency, accuracy, and ease of use in their 3D printing projects.

Specifications:

Printing Technology:Fused deposition modeling
Leveling Mode:Hands-free auto leveling

Build Volume:220*220*250mm
File Transfer:USB drive, WiFi

Product Dimensions:355*355*482mm
Display Screen:4.3″ color touch screen

Package Dimensions:441*441*578mm
AI Camera:Yes

Net Weight:12.4kg
Power Loss Recovery:Yes

Gross Weight:18.9kg
Filament Runout Sensor:Yes

Printing Speed:≤600mm/s
Air Purifier:Yes

Acceleration:≤20000mm/s²
Input Shaping:Yes

Printing Accuracy:100±0.1mm
Lighting kit:Yes

Layer Height:0.1-0.35mm
Sleep Mode:Yes

Extruder:Clog-free direct drive extruder
Rated Voltage:100-120V~, 200-240V~, 50/60Hz

Filament Diameter:1.75mm
Rated Power:350V

Nozzle Diameter:0.4mm
Supported Filaments:ABS, PLA, PETG, PET, TPU, PA, ABS, ASA, PC, PLA-CF, PA-CF, PET-CF

Nozzle Temperature:≤300℃
Printable File Format:G-Code

Heatbed Temperature:≤100℃
Slicing Software:Creality Print, Cura 5.0 and later version

Build Surface:PEI flexible build plate
File Formats for Slicing:STL, OBJ, 3MF

UI Languages:English, Spanish, German, French, Russian, Portuguese, Italian, Turkish, Japanese, Chinese

FAQs for Creality K1C 3D Printer

What is the Creality K1C 3D Printer and how does it work?
The Creality K1C 3D Printer is a high-performance, dual-gear extruder 3D printer designed for high-speed and high-precision printing. It uses Fused Deposition Modelling (FDM) technology to layer melted filament onto the print bed, building objects layer by layer. The K1C features AI-assisted functions for optimised printing and auto bed levelling for hassle-free setup.
What is the maximum print speed of the Creality K1C 3D Printer?
The Creality K1C 3D Printer can print at speeds of up to 300mm/s, allowing you to complete prints faster compared to traditional 3D printers without compromising quality. This makes it perfect for rapid prototyping and efficient production.
Can the Creality K1C 3D Printer print with flexible materials like TPU?
Yes, the Creality K1C 3D Printer is compatible with a variety of filaments, including TPU (flexible filament), PLA, PETG, ABS, and more. This versatility allows you to print a wide range of projects, from flexible items to sturdy prototypes.
What is the build volume of the Creality K1C 3D Printer?
The Creality K1C has a build volume of 220mm x 220mm x 250mm, which is perfect for printing detailed models and prototypes. While it’s a compact model, it offers ample space for most printing needs.
What are the key features of the Creality K1C 3D Printer?

High-speed printing of up to 300mm/s.

    • Dual-gear direct drive extruder for consistent and precise filament flow.
    • AI-assisted functions for real-time monitoring and optimisation.
    • Hands-free auto bed leveling for precision and convenience.
    • Wide filament compatibility including PLA, PETG, ABS, and TPU.
    • 4.3″ color touchscreen for easy operation.

Does the Creality K1C 3D Printer require assembly?
No, the Creality K1C 3D Printer comes fully assembled and ready to use. This makes it a great option for both beginners and experienced users who want a hassle-free setup.
How do I connect the Creality K1C 3D Printer to my network?
The Creality K1C 3D Printer can be connected via Wi-Fi, USB, or Ethernet. These options provide flexibility in how you control and send print jobs to the printer, making it easy to integrate into your workflow.
What slicing software is compatible with the Creality K1C 3D Printer?
The Creality K1C 3D Printer is compatible with Creality Print and other popular slicing software such as Cura, Simplify3D, and PrusaSlicer. These programs allow you to prepare your 3D models in STL, OBJ, or AMF file formats for printing.
